What Chicago's Environment Does to Water Heaters

The lake moderates summer season warmth a little bit, yet it likewise pulls dampness right into autumn and springtime. Winters are cool and extended, and the chilly water entering your heating unit can run 35 to 45 levels Fahrenheit. same day water heater installation Chicago That broad delta from inlet to setpoint temperature level indicates your heating unit functions harder for more months of the year. Gas models cycle regularly. Electric elements run longer sessions. Tankless systems are pressed to the top side of their circulation rankings when two components open at once.

Hard water substances the stress and anxiety. Lots of Chicago areas examination at moderate to high solidity, which speeds up range buildup on electric components and gas-fired heat transfer surface areas. I have actually drained pipes containers where the lower 6 inches were obstructed with crunchy mineral debris, reducing efficient ability and covering up thermostat concerns. Cold air infiltration is an additional wrongdoer, specifically in cellars with older single-pane windows or drafty bulkhead doors. Combustion appliances need air, but way too much uncontrolled air chills the container and flue, increases condensation, and triggers periodic flame-sensing faults.

If your hot water heater is near an outside wall surface or in a garage, the impacts appear sooner. Burners rust. Air vent adapters drip. Condensate swimming pools where it shouldn't. Plan for examination and solution cadence that values these realities. A heater that would certainly run 8 to ten years in a mild climate might need focus by year 6 here.

How to Place Trouble Before It Spikes

Most failings give warnings. You just need to recognize them and act. A few area notes:

A hot water supply that turns from warm to scalding and back suggests a stopping working thermostat or blocked mixing shutoff. On gas units, irregular temperature frequently starts after debris has actually buried the bottom, developing hot spots that puzzle the control.

Popping, rumbling, or a gravelly sound throughout heater cycles often indicates scale and debris. The noise is steam standing out beneath layers of mineral buildup, which also steals performance. In worst situations the roaring drinks apart dip tubes and anode rods.

Rust-tinted warm water that clears after a couple of mins usually implies an anode rod has actually been taken in and the tank is beginning to rust. If the staining shows up on both hot and cold, look upstream at the building's piping, yet do not reject the heating system without drawing the anode for inspection.

Drips near the temperature level and pressure safety valve can be misleading. If the shutoff cries just throughout a home heating cycle after that quits, thermal development may be driving stress beyond the shutoff's limit. Chicago homes with shut systems or check valves on the water meter commonly require a properly sized expansion tank. If the shutoff weeps constantly, replace it and examination system pressure.

Intermittent hot water on a tankless device when you open a solitary low-flow faucet can indicate the minimum circulation sensing unit isn't being activated. Mineral range in the warmth exchanger is an usual reason. Do not maintain increasing the temperature to make up, you'll create a scald danger and still get warm water.

Gas smell, blister marks, or residue around the heater area means shut it down and call a professional. In older basements with lint and family pet hair, I typically find flame rollout proof from clogged up burning air intakes.

Repair or Change: The Real Equation

I do not make use of a strict age cutoff, however age issues. Most conventional glass-lined tanks last 8 to 12 years when sensibly kept. In systems with overlooked anodes or severe water problems, 6 to 8 years is common. At the 10-year mark, even with a clean burner and audio controls, inside tank wear ends up being the coin toss you won't such as. If the storage tank itself leakages, replacement is non-negotiable. No sealer or epoxy is more than a short-term bandage.

For repair service candidates, I take a look at part expenses, accessibility, and expected horizon. Changing gas control valves, thermocouples, igniters, or thermostats usually makes sense for younger devices. So does swapping a failed heating element on an electrical design. Anode poles are affordable insurance policy, and I have replaced them on storage tanks as old as year 9 when the inside still looked suitable. But if the heater setting up is rusted, the flue baffle is deformed, or you can't separate the leakage without pressurizing, I nudge homeowners toward replacement.

Efficiency gains often tip the equilibrium. Newer gas or crossbreed electrical versions use much less power per gallon supplied, and tankless devices have enhanced regulating controls that react far better to Chicago's chilly inlet water. If your existing heater is undersized, replacing with the correct ability or a tankless system addresses both reliability and comfort.

Sizing for Real-life Chicago Use

A well-sized system doesn't chase after peak draw, it satisfies it without throwing away gas the various other 23 hours. Sizing obtains more difficult when a home has an older whirlpool bathtub, a multi-head shower, or a cellar home with an extra bath.

For containers, total shower room count, tenancy, and fixture behaviors drive the option. A house of four with 2 complete bathrooms and typical morning overlap seldom is sorry for a 50-gallon affordable water heater service Chicago gas container if the recovery rate is solid. A 40-gallon design can benefit self-displined regimens, but if both showers run and laundry starts, it will certainly fail. Electric storage tanks need bigger abilities to match the recuperation of gas. I usually spec 65 to 80 gallons for all-electric houses with 2 or even more baths.

For tankless, match the unit to the coldest expected inbound temperature and synchronised circulation. In Chicago winters months, plan for a temperature level surge of 70 to 85 degrees. Two showers plus a sink could require 6 to 8 gallons per minute at that surge. Makers checklist flow ability at particular delta-T worths. Review those tables, not just the heading GPM. If space allows, some two-flats take advantage of 2 smaller sized tankless devices in parallel as opposed to one large device, which improves redundancy and regulates much more effectively on reduced draws.

Gas, Electric, Crossbreed, or Tankless: Making a Durable Choice

There is no widely ideal choice. Your gas line dimension, airing vent course, electrical capability, and area design identify what's sensible. After that the mathematics of energy prices and your use patterns complete the picture.

Traditional gas container water heaters sit in the wonderful area of expense, simple setup, and dependable healing. They know to examiners and solution techs. If you have a suitable smokeshaft or a direct-vent path, they work well in a lot of Chicago basements. They are delicate to cosmetics air and airing vent problem, which is why you need to examine the flue consistently for rust or ice dams near the cap.

High-efficiency gas with power air vent or condensing styles makes use of PVC venting and can be extra effective, especially when you can't rely upon a masonry smokeshaft. They require an appropriate condensate drainpipe line that will not freeze. The air vent runs need to be pitched to drain pipes, and the discontinuation should be sited to prevent snow drift zones.

Electric tanks are less complex mechanically, without any burning or airing vent to worry about. They can be excellent in apartments or structures without gas. The compromise is recovery speed and electric load. If your panel is maxed out already, including a big electrical heating unit might force a solution upgrade.

Hybrid heatpump hot water heater shine in removed homes with adequate space and light ambient temperatures. They pull warm from the bordering air and are really reliable. In Chicago cellars, they still work, however they cool down and evaporate the space. That can be an advantage in summertime, a drawback in winter. Clearances, condensate handling, and sound matter, particularly if the system is near a living location. I've installed crossbreeds in laundry rooms where the dryer's waste heat assists, but in little mechanical storage rooms they can struggle.

Tankless gas systems maximize flooring room and deliver endless hot water within their flow limitations. They are delicate to water quality and need normal descaling. Venting is normally secured and sidewall-terminated, which often simplifies flue problems. They do require adequate gas supply, sometimes upsizing the line to 3/4 inch or larger. Properly mounted and maintained, they last a long period of time and maintain costs predictable.

Chicago Structure Facts: Venting, Permits, and Access

Venting is where several do it yourself efforts go laterally. Older two-flats and cottages typically share a smokeshaft flue between the hot water heater and an atmospheric furnace. If the heating system gets changed with a high-efficiency version that airs vent via PVC, the water heater ends up alone in a too-large smokeshaft. That changes draft qualities and threats condensation inside the stonework. I have measured flue gas temperatures that go down as well quickly, merging acidic condensate in linings. If you go this course, take into consideration a properly sized steel lining or change the heating system to a power-vent or direct-vent model.

Chicago's permitting procedure for hot water heater installment is simple when you comply with code and give fundamental documentation. Anticipate gas stress tests for new or altered lines, burning air estimations if you are staying with climatic devices, and examination of TPR discharge piping. In older buildings, inspectors likewise consider bonding and grounding of steel water lines. Scheduling is simpler midweek and outside holiday weeks. If your building is a condo, consider board authorizations and lift reservations for moving tanks.

Access forms labor time. Yard systems with narrow gangways and low stairwell turns restriction tank dimension merely because you can not physically maneuver a bigger cyndrical tube. I've had work where a 50-gallon storage tank had to be taken apart to remove, after that we shifted to a tankless to avoid future gain access to migraines. Step entrances, transforms, and ceiling heights before you decide on a model.

Maintenance That In fact Expands Life

Yearly service defeats shock failures. In our climate, the complying with cadence works. Drain pipes a couple of gallons from the tank every 6 months to flush sediment. Complete flushes are perfect if the shutoff is durable, yet I have actually seen old plastic drain valves snap. If the shutoff really feels lightweight, a partial drainpipe and refill is safer. On electrical tanks, kill power first and check element resistance with a multimeter while you're there.

Inspect and replace the anode pole every 2 to 3 years. In high-hardness areas, magnesium anodes dissolve swiftly. An aluminum-zinc anode can slow odor issues from sulfur bacteria and lasts a bit much longer. If you do not have overhanging clearance, utilize a segmented anode. When anodes are disregarded, the container becomes the sacrificial metal, and failure accelerates.

For gas versions, vacuum cleaner dirt and lint from same day water heater service Chicago the burner area. Clean flame-sensing rods carefully with a great abrasive pad. Check that the fire is stable and primarily blue with well-defined cones. Lazy yellow fires suggest inadequate combustion or blocked air. Validate that the draft hood is attracting by holding a smoke resource near it while the heater runs. If smoke splashes out, quit and address venting.

Tankless devices require annual descaling in many Chicago communities. Utilize a pump, pipes, and a descaling option to distribute with the warm exchanger. Clean inlet filters. Confirm the condensate neutralizer media is still reliable on condensing versions. I have actually seen overlooked tankless devices keep up half the anticipated flow due to the fact that the exchanger was lined with mineral crust.

Expansion tanks are worthy of a pressure check too. With the system chilly and stress relieved, the development tank's air side should match your home's static water stress, usually 50 to 60 psi. A waterlogged growth storage tank develops annoyance TPR discharges and shortens the life of valves and gaskets downstream.

Realistic Cost Varies and What Drives Them

Costs vary by access, brand name, service warranty, and code requirements. A straightforward repair like a thermocouple or igniter on a gas container might land in a moderate variety, while a control shutoff or electrical element can be greater. Full water heater setup in Chicago for a typical atmospheric gas storage tank normally includes the device, new flex ports, drip leg, TPR piping to code, permit, and haul-away of the old storage tank. Include costs for a brand-new chimney liner if needed, or for a power-vent version with lengthy air vent runs and condensate drainpipe configuration.

Tankless setups have a bigger spread. If the gas line need to be upsized and the vent course drilled via masonry with a long term, the labor rises. Descaling valves and isolation sets add price ahead of time but conserve operating expenditure later. Crossbreed heatpump set you back more than basic electrical storage tanks, and you may require a condensate pump, vibration isolation pads, and potentially a tiny duct kit to optimize airflow.

Ask for detailed quotes so you can see where the money goes. Reduced quotes that leave out authorization costs, airing vent upgrades, or growth storage tanks frequently balloon later on or cause a system that works poorly.

Seasonal Tips That Pay Off

Before the very first hard freeze, walk the outside. If your heating system vents via a sidewall, check the termination for insect nests or debris. Verify the termination is high sufficient over grade to stay clear of snow blockage. Inside your home, verify that the condensate lines on power-vent or condensing devices are sloped and that catches consist of water to avoid exhaust recirculation.

During long cold snaps, listen for brand-new rattles or changes in burner audio. Abrupt boosts in burner noise or prolonged shooting cycles often associate flue limitations or hefty sediment movement. On incredibly gusty days, sidewall-vented units can short-cycle from pressure disturbances near the air vent. Proper vent discontinuation placement reduces this; including a wind-resistant cap can help.

In spring, moisture climbs up and basement dampness rises. Look for rust on copper-to-steel shifts and at the nipples in addition to the tank. I commonly see early rust at these joints from small sweating, Chicago water heater service not from leaks. A basic wipe-down and evaluation routine when a month tells you a lot.

What Makes a Good Installation, Not Simply a Brand-new Heater

A neat set up is greater than clean piping. It indicates proper combustion air computations, vent pitch, gas sizing, dielectric isolation in between different steels, and a drip leg on the gas line. It implies the TPR discharge does not run uphill which the frying pan under the heating unit, if utilized, has a drain to someplace that can take care of water. It additionally indicates sensible discussion concerning water top quality. In some homes, a point-of-entry conditioner can include years to the system. In others, an easy scale prevention cartridge upstream of a tankless system is enough.

Documentation matters. Maintain your authorization, design numbers, guarantee info, and a basic solution log. When you call for water heater repair service in Chicago years later, handing a technology those notes conserves diagnostic time and decreases billable hours.

What are the 4 types of water heaters?

The four main types of water heaters are tank (storage) heaters, tankless (on-demand) heaters, heat pump water heaters, and solar water heaters. Tank heaters store heated water, while tankless units heat water on demand. Heat pumps and solar models use energy-efficient methods for heating water.

How many years will a water heater last?

The lifespan of a water heater depends on its type and maintenance. Tank water heaters typically last 8 to 12 years, while tankless models can last 15 to 20 years. Regular maintenance can extend the life of any water heater.
